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  Marked Items |  All
Print Page as PDF
Routine: ACHSPCC1

Package: Contract Health Management Information System

Routine: ACHSPCC1


Information

ACHSPCC1 ; IHS/ITSC/TPF/PMF - CHS AREA SPLITOUT (1/5) ; JUL 10, 2008

Source Information

Source file <ACHSPCC1.m>

Call Graph

Call Graph Total: 8

Package Total Call Graph
Contract Health Management Information System 4 ($$AOP,$$LOC)^ACHS  ^ACHSPCC3  (ENTRETRN,JOBABEND)^ACHSPCC4  ^ACHSPCCR  
IHS VA Utilities 2 $$DIR^XBDIR  $$C^XBFUNC  
Kernel 2 (,HOME)^%ZIS  $$FMTE^XLFDT  

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Contract Health Management Information System 2 ACHSACO  ACHSAREA SP/EX  

Entry Points

Name Comments DBIA/ICR reference
RJEPCC ;;Default RJE # for ITS (Parklawn) Missing
RJEBCS ;;Default RJE # for the Fiscal Intemediary Missing
ERR(X) ;
EFFD ;
PCC ;;COMPUTER CENTER entry Missing for ITS (Parklawn)
CPFXERR ;
BCS ;;COMPUTER CENTER entry Missing for the Fiscal Intemediary

External References

Name Field # of Occurrence
^%ZIS EFFD+7
HOME^%ZIS ACHSPCC1+4, EFFD+9
$$AOP^ACHS ACHSPCC1+35
$$LOC^ACHS ERR+2
^ACHSPCC3 EFFD+15
ENTRETRN^ACHSPCC4 CPFXERR+2
JOBABEND^ACHSPCC4 ACHSPCC1+9, ACHSPCC1+15, ACHSPCC1+37, ACHSPCC1+38, EFFD+2, EFFD+9, ERR+3
^ACHSPCCR EFFD+13
$$DIR^XBDIR ACHSPCC1+37, EFFD+1
$$C^XBFUNC ACHSPCC1+29
$$FMTE^XLFDT ACHSPCC1+8, EFFD+1

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!?10,"CHS FACILITY FILES ALREADY PROCESSED ON ",$$FMTE^XLFDT($P(^ACHSPCC("ODF-POST"),U,1)),!!?10,"JOB CANCELLED"
  • Line Location: ACHSPCC1+8
Function Call: WRITE
  • Prompt: *7,!,"ACCOUNTING POINT NUMBER is missing from RPMS SITE file...",!
  • Line Location: ACHSPCC1+14
Function Call: WRITE
  • Prompt: !,$$C^XBFUNC("AREA PREFIX="_$E(ACHSPFX,2,3)),!
  • Line Location: ACHSPCC1+29
Function Call: WRITE
  • Prompt: !,"Your CHS FACILITY DHR Transactions Should be TRANSMITTED to:"
  • Line Location: ACHSPCC1+33
Function Call: WRITE
  • Prompt: !?10,"(1) United Finacial Management System for Federal Facilities"
  • Line Location: ACHSPCC1+34
Function Call: WRITE
  • Prompt: !?10,$S($$AOP^ACHS(2,3)="Y":"(2) Fiscal Intermediary",1:" ")
  • Line Location: ACHSPCC1+35
Function Call: WRITE
  • Prompt: *7," CAN'T BE FUTURE DATE"
  • Line Location: EFFD+3
Function Call: WRITE
  • Prompt: !
  • Line Location: EFFD+5
Function Call: WRITE
  • Prompt: *7,!!?12," CAN NUMBER PREFIX NOT CORRECTLY DEFINED FOR THIS FACILITY",!,"PREFIX = '",ACHSPFX,"'",!!?35,"JOB CANCELLED",!!
  • Line Location: CPFXERR+1
Function Call: WRITE
  • Prompt: *7,!!?10,$P($T(@X),";",3)
  • Line Location: ERR+1
Function Call: WRITE
  • Prompt: !?10,"In IHS COMMUNICATIONS PARAMETERS file for ",$$LOC^ACHS
  • Line Location: ERR+2
Routine Call
  • %ZIS
  • Line Location:
    • ACHSPCC1+4
    • EFFD+9
Routine Call
  • %ZIS
  • Line Location:
    • EFFD+7

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^ACHSPCC("ODF-POST" ACHSPCC1+6, ACHSPCC1+8
^AUTTAREA - [#9999999.21] ACHSPCC1+11
^AUTTLOC - [#9999999.06] ACHSPCC1+11
^AUTTSITE(1 ACHSPCC1+12
^AUTTTEL - [#9999999.71] ACHSPCC1+17, ACHSPCC1+19, ACHSPCC1+21, ACHSPCC1+22, ACHSPCC1+23, ACHSPCC1+24

Label References

Name Line Occurrences
CPFXERR ACHSPCC1+26, ACHSPCC1+27, ACHSPCC1+28
EFFD EFFD+3
ERR ACHSPCC1+18, ACHSPCC1+20, ACHSPCC1+21, ACHSPCC1+23, ACHSPCC1+25

Naked Globals

Name Field # of Occurrence
^(0 ACHSPCC1+11

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
%ZIS EFFD+6*, EFFD+8!
%ZIS("A" EFFD+6*
>> ACHSAPN ACHSPCC1+12*, ACHSPCC1+13
>> ACHSAREA ACHSPCC1+11*
>> ACHSCCTR EFFD+10*
>> ACHSCT2 EFFD+13*
>> ACHSEFDT EFFD+1*, EFFD+2, EFFD+3, EFFD+4*
>> ACHSFIRN ACHSPCC1+24*, ACHSPCC1+25
>> ACHSFLG EFFD+14
>> ACHSHASH EFFD+13*
>> ACHSIO ACHSPCC1+5*
>> ACHSPFX ACHSPCC1+11*, ACHSPCC1+26, ACHSPCC1+27, ACHSPCC1+28, ACHSPCC1+29, CPFXERR+1
>> ACHSPRN ACHSPCC1+19*, ACHSPCC1+20
>> ACHSPTRD EFFD+10*
DT EFFD+1, EFFD+3
>> DTOUT ACHSPCC1+38, EFFD+2
>> DUOUT ACHSPCC1+38, EFFD+2
DUZ(2 ACHSPCC1+11, ACHSPCC1+17, ACHSPCC1+19, ACHSPCC1+21, ACHSPCC1+22, ACHSPCC1+23, ACHSPCC1+24
IO ACHSPCC1+5, EFFD+10
IO(0 ACHSPCC1+7, ACHSPCC1+30, ACHSPCC1+36
>> POP EFFD+9
U ACHSPCC1+8, ACHSPCC1+11, ACHSPCC1+12, ACHSPCC1+19, ACHSPCC1+24
X ACHSPCC1+11*, ACHSPCC1+17*, ACHSPCC1+18, ACHSPCC1+19, ACHSPCC1+22*, ACHSPCC1+23, ACHSPCC1+24, ERR~
>> Y EFFD+4

Marked Items

Name Field # of Occurrence
$T(@X ERR+1
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ables |  Marked Items |  All